I really don't know if this came out in the past, but I would like to share a tip that I use since I had a Nokia 7160 (7110 TDMA).
I hate the all polished out cellphone screens, because they are really easy to scratch, and because if you use your phone a lot, you will sweat and get a messy cellphone screen.
What I use to do: I also have a palm Vx. And I bought writeright, a thin plastic film that you use on the palm screen, to avoid scratches and to write "smoother". I love this product.
Well, I just cut a piece the size of the cellphone screen and applied it. Perfect match! My 7160 screen is like new, and now I can touch the t68 screen without problems. also easier to clean up.
